The Versatility And Durability Of Stainless Steel Windows

stainless steel windows are a popular choice for both residential and commercial buildings due to their durability, aesthetic appeal, and excellent performance. These windows are made from high-quality steel that resists corrosion, rust, and stains, making them ideal for long-term use in various environments.

One of the primary advantages of stainless steel windows is their versatility. These windows can be customized to fit any size or shape, allowing for a seamless integration into any architectural design. Whether used in modern skyscrapers or traditional homes, stainless steel windows can provide a sleek and sophisticated look that enhances the overall appearance of the building.

In addition to their aesthetic appeal, stainless steel windows are also incredibly durable. Unlike other window materials such as wood or aluminum, stainless steel does not warp, crack, or fade over time. This means that stainless steel windows require minimal maintenance and can last for decades without losing their visual appeal. This durability makes stainless steel windows a cost-effective option, as they eliminate the need for frequent repairs or replacements.

Another key benefit of stainless steel windows is their energy efficiency. These windows are excellent insulators, keeping heat inside during the winter and outside during the summer. This helps reduce energy costs by keeping the building at a consistent temperature year-round. Additionally, stainless steel windows are also environmentally friendly, as they can be recycled at the end of their lifespan, reducing the overall carbon footprint of the building.

stainless steel windows are also known for their security features. The strength of stainless steel makes it difficult to break or tamper with, providing an added layer of protection for the building’s occupants. This makes stainless steel windows an ideal choice for high-security facilities such as banks, government buildings, and museums.

In terms of maintenance, stainless steel windows are relatively easy to care for. Regular cleaning with a mild detergent and water is usually sufficient to keep these windows looking like new. Additionally, stainless steel is resistant to scratches and dents, further contributing to their longevity and durability.
